A women led, global ecumenical movement – annually first Friday in March Friday 6th March at 2pm at St Mary’s RC Church, Bond End, Knaresborough . Our sisters in Nigeria invite us to join them for the World Day of Prayer. The service they have prepared reflects the theme, “I will give your rest”. 120 participating countries will be celebrating this service on the same day. It begins in Samoa and moves across the world in a continuous wave of prayer, finishing 38 hours later in American Samoa. It truly is a worldwide day of prayer. The World Day of Prayer is an international women-led ecumenical movement that shares the hopes, concerns and prayers of women from around the globe. Each year women from a different country craft a service, sharing their unique spiritual journey and culture. For 2026 the women of Nigeria have created a service that speaks to our need for peace and solace, drawing on their faith and experiences in a world filled with struggles and anxieties. This is the first time for more than 10 years that St Mary’s have held the service - next year it will be held at St John’s CofE. Please support us. Refreshments will be served in the Hall following. Pope Leo published his World Day of Peace message shortly before Christmas. It is such a timely and rich message in today's troubled world. Affirming again that nonviolence is the key to peace, the message addresses the escalation of war, rearmament and fear in international relations. Pope Leo reiterates the Church’s opposition to deterrence based on military force and calls for disarmament, dialogue and the conversion of hearts as necessary conditions for a lasting and unarmed peace.
